Galataport puts you within 20 minutes of Hagia Sophia, the Blue Mosque, and the Grand Bazaar — a rare cruise-port geography where the headline sights are genuinely close to the pier. The great church-turned-mosque-turned-mosque again — its vast golden dome, Byzantine mosaics, and layered 1,500-year history make it Istanbul's most unmissable interior.

The Ottoman sultans' hilltop seat of empire for four centuries — its treasury, harem, and imperial kitchens overlook both the Bosphorus and the Golden Horn.

The underground Byzantine reservoir beneath the old city — 336 marble columns, dim lighting, and the famous upside-down Medusa-head bases.

The six-minaret imperial mosque just across the hippodrome from Hagia Sophia, famous for its cascade of domes and 20,000 hand-painted İznik tiles.

One of the world's oldest and largest covered markets — 4,000 shops across 61 streets selling ceramics, spices, jewellery, and carpets under a vaulted Ottoman roof.

The medieval Genoese tower across the Golden Horn — a short but steep climb rewarded with a 360-degree panorama of both shores and the Bosphorus.

Galataport is roughly 20 minutes by private car from Sultanahmet — one of the shortest port-to-centre runs in the Eastern Mediterranean. Hagia Sophia, the Blue Mosque, Topkapı Palace, and the Grand Bazaar all cluster within the same old-city neighbourhood, so a single port day covers the highlights without long drives between stops.
